Our Mission
The African American and Jamaican Chamber of Commerce (AAJCC) stands as a vital institution committed to the profound mission of fostering comprehensive economic empowerment for its diverse membership and the communities it serves. This dedication is realized through a strategic, multifaceted approach centered on three core pillars: visionary leadership, impactful advocacy, and the systematic creation of targeted resources and initiatives.
Our visionary leadership involves setting a clear, forward-looking agenda that identifies and capitalizes on emerging economic opportunities, while also proactively addressing systemic barriers to growth. This includes developing strategic partnerships with government entities, private corporations, and other non-profit organizations to create a cohesive ecosystem of support. We believe that empowering our members begins with providing a clear roadmap for success in an ever-evolving global marketplace.
Furthermore, the AAJCC engages in impactful advocacy at local, state, and national levels. This advocacy is focused on influencing policy decisions that promote equitable access to capital, contracts, and business development opportunities for minority-owned enterprises. We serve as a powerful, unified voice, championing legislative and regulatory changes that dismantle institutional obstacles and level the economic playing field for African American and Jamaican entrepreneurs and professionals.

Our Goal
Our goal is to ensure success by creating and delivering targeted resources and initiatives. These programs are designed to meet the specific needs of our community, including business mentorship programs, financial literacy workshops, access to networking events, and training in areas such as technology adoption and global market entry. These tools are designed not merely to sustain businesses, but to ensure they thrive, scale, and become durable engines of job creation and wealth generation.
Ultimately, the Chamber’s unwavering goal is to ensure that every individual within our community has a tangible and equitable opportunity to build a better and more prosperous future for themselves and their families, thereby contributing to the overall economic strength and vitality of the broader society.
